2 Samuel 24:16
What meaning of the 2 samuel 24:16 in the Bible?
What does 2 Samuel 24:16 mean? Bible commentary, explanation and study verse by verse — free.
"And when the angel stretched out his hand upon Jerusalem to destroy it, the LORD repented him of the evil, and said to the angel that destroyed the people, It is enough: stay now thine hand. And the angel of the LORD was by the threshingplace of Araunahc the Jebusite."
